C là một ngôn ngữ khôn cùng phổ biến, và nó là ngôn ngữ của không ít ứng dụng như Windows, trình thông ngôn Python, Git và những thứ không giống nữa. Bởi là ngôn ngữ thịnh hành nên những nhà lập trình nào thì cũng phải theo học. Giả dụ như học không tồn tại định hướng, không tồn tại giáo trình thì sẽ khá mơ hồ. Cũng chính vì vậy mà hôm nay ustone.com.vn share đến cho mình toàn cỗ tài liệu xây dựng C cho người mới ban đầu học.

Bạn đang xem: Học c++ cho người mới bắt đầu

Được nhận xét là ngôn ngữ lập trình cung cấp cao, được sử dụng phổ cập để lập trình khối hệ thống cùng với Assembler và cách tân và phát triển các ứng dụng. Ngôn từ có một khối hệ thống rất mạnh cùng rất “mềm dẻo” tất cả một thư viện gồm không ít các hàm (function) vẫn được tạo nên sẵn. Thiết kế viên rất có thể tận dụng các hàm này để xử lý các việc mà không nhất thiết phải tạo mới.


*

Tài liệu lập trình C


Ứng dụng của ngôn ngữ lập trình C cũng nằm ngoài tưởng tượng của những nhà lập trình. Cũng chính vì thế, ustone.com.vn đã thâu tóm được điều đó và muốn share đến cho các bạn bộ tài liệu lập trình C cho người mới ban đầu cực kỳ trung khu đắc! Hãy cùng tìm hiểu ngay thôi nhé!

C là gì?

C được phổ cập khá rộng rãi và đã trở thành một lý lẽ lập trình khá mạnh, được thực hiện như là một ngôn ngữ lập trình đa phần trong việc xây dựng những phần mềm hiện nay. Ngày C chủ yếu thức trình làng bởi Dennis M. Ritchie để cách tân và phát triển hệ quản lý UNIX, nó được cách tân và phát triển như một dự án công trình mở hoàn hảo và tuyệt vời nhất cho các nhà lập trình sẵn viên học tập tập. Ứng dụng chủ yếu của C để kết hợp với Assembly để viết các trình điều khiển, hệ quản lý và điều hành và ngôn ngữ khác như C++, Python, Java… ngữ điệu C được trở nên tân tiến để tạo ra các ứng dụng hệ thống trực tiếp liên can với các thiết bị phần cứng, mã C rất có thể được dịch với thi hành trong phần lớn các máy tính . Thiết kế C được xem là cơ sở cho những ngôn ngữ lập trình sẵn khác, chúng ta có thể xác định ngôn từ C bằng các cách như sau:

C được coi như như ngôn ngữ mẹ

Hầu hết các trình biên dịch, sản phẩm ảo Java, JVMs,.. Những được viết bằng ngôn từ C. Nó cung ứng các khái niệm chủ quản như mảng, chuỗi, hàm, đặc tả tập tin,… đang rất được sử dụng trong không ít ngôn ngữ khác như C++, Java, C#,…

Ngôn ngữ thiết kế hệ thống

C rất có thể được dùng làm lập trình ở tại mức thấp, nó thường xuyên được sử dụng để tạo nên các máy phần cứng, hệ điều hành, trình điều khiển,.. Vậy cần C được gọi là một trong ngôn ngữ lập trình sẵn hệ thống. Nó chẳng thể được sử dụng trong các chương trình internet như java, .net, php vv.

Ngôn ngữ lập trình sẵn thủ tục

Ngôn ngữ giấy tờ thủ tục chỉ định một chuỗi công việc để lập trình hoàn toàn có thể giải quyết vấn đề, nó chia bé dại lập trình thành những hàm, kết cấu dữ liệu,… vào C, bạn sẽ phải khai báo những biến và các nguyên chủng loại hàm trước khi sử dụng chúng.

Ngôn ngữ lập trình tất cả cấu trúc

Ngôn ngữ xây dựng có cấu trúc là một tập hợp con của ngôn từ có cấu trúc. Để lập trình trở nên dễ nắm bắt và dễ sửa đổi hơn, vào C chúng ta sẽ chia nhỏ lập trình bằng phương pháp sử dụng những hàm.

Ngôn ngữ lập trình cấp cho trung

Vì rất có thể hỗ trợ công dụng của cả ngôn từ cấp thấp và ngôn từ cấp cao phải C được coi là ngôn ngữ lập trình cấp cho trung. Chương trình ngữ điệu C được chuyển đổi thành mã assembly, cung ứng số học nhỏ trỏ (cấp thấp), cơ mà nó là vật dụng tính độc lập (tính năng cao cấp).

Xem thêm: 9999+ Những Câu Nói Hay Về Phụ Nữ Mạnh Mẽ, Just A Moment

*

Ưu cùng nhược điểm khi tham gia học ngôn ngữ lập trình C

Ưu điểm:

C hoàn toàn có thể chạy quyến rũ và mềm mại trên trên những khối hệ thống giới hạn về dung lượng. Bạn cũng có thể chạy một chương trình bằng C và gán bộ nhớ cùng một cơ hội ngay cả khi bạn không biết các đối tượng người dùng trong công tác này yêu thương cầu bao nhiêu bộ nhớ.C cung ứng thư viện chuẩn chỉnh với hàng trăm ngàn hàm chức năng, điều khoản toán học,.. Việc áp dụng thuật toán và kết cấu dữ liệu trong C đã giúp cho chương trình giám sát rất nhanh và mượt mà. C hỗ trợ rất không ít phong cách dữ liệu khác biệt và việc chuyển đổi cũng khá dễ dàng.C rất có thể dùng có các ứng dụng trên hệ thống 8 bit tốt 64 bit các được, tất cả những gì cần thiết là compiler phù hợp. Chúng ta có thể chạy mã của bản thân mình trên ngẫu nhiên máy nào mà lại không cần triển khai việc biến đổi mã hoặc chỉ cần chuyển đổi một vài cụ thể trong mã.

Nhược điểm:

Đối với C, các lỗi sẽ được hiển thị sau thời điểm viết chương trình, điều này khiến cho việc kiểm tra mã rất phức hợp trong những chương trình lớn.Các byte vùng nhớ cấp phát mảng được bố trí liên tục, câu hỏi chèn cùng xóa phần tử của mảng mất nhiều thời gian.C không tồn tại tính năng xử trí ngoại lệ, đây là tính năng khá đặc trưng vì trong những lúc biên dịch mã hoàn toàn có thể xảy ra các lỗi và khác thường khác nhau. Cập nhật ngoại lệ sẽ giúp bạn bắt lỗi và thực hiện các đánh giá thích hợp.
*

Tài liệu lập trình sẵn c cho người mới bắt đầu


Ứng dụng của ngôn ngữ lập trình C cũng nằm kế bên tưởng tượng của các nhà lập trình. Cũng chính vì thế, ustone.com.vn đã nắm bắt được điều này và muốn share đến cho chúng ta bộ tài liệu xây dựng C cho những người mới ban đầu cực kỳ vai trung phong đắc! Hãy cùng tò mò ngay thôi nhé!

Giới thiệu về tài liệu lập trình C

Bộ tài liệu lập trình sẵn C nhưng mà ustone.com.vn sẽ chia sẻ ở ngay bên ngay tiếp sau đây sẽ là một trong những nền tảng cơ sở vững chắc cho tín đồ mới bước đầu và người đang xuất hiện ý định theo đuổi say mê trên con đường trở nên tân tiến phần mềm.


*

Tài liệu lập trình C


C được phát triển ban đầu cho việc cải tiến và phát triển hệ thống, nhất là các hệ điều hành. C được bằng lòng như là 1 trong trong những ngôn ngữ cải tiến và phát triển hệ thống bởi nó cung cung cấp code cùng chạy một quãng code một các lập cập như các ngôn ngữ hình dạng Assemly. Với các ai đang còn tồn tại ý định theo đuổi mê man với con phố lập trình C thì TẢI NGAY cỗ tài liệu dưới đây nhé!

Download một vài bộ tài liệu lập trình sẵn C cho tất cả những người mới bắt đầu

Việc tự học tập lập trình bằng tài liệu thiết kế C cũng trở nên không mất thời gian bởi tư liệu được biên soạn rất kỹ thuật và rõ ràng, những phần mục được chia ví dụ để tín đồ học dễ thâu tóm và tưởng tượng ra mình nên làm như vậy nào. Tài liệu lập trình sẵn C kèm theo các ví dụ thực hành được hướng dẫn cụ thể để bạn học nắm rõ hơn về vấn đề đang được đề cập đến. Rộng nữa, nếu khách hàng có một kế hoạch và kế hoạch học tập khoa học và tuân thủ nghiêm ngặt thì câu hỏi tự học lập trình C cũng trở thành đơn giản hơn nhiều.

Khi bước đầu học bất kể một thứ gì các bạn cũng sẽ gặp gỡ những khó khăn nhất định dẫu vậy nếu kiên cường và thực hành tiếp tục thì bạn sẽ nhanh chóng làm chủ được nó và áp dụng vào công việc của mình nhằm đạt được kết quả cao.

TẢI ngay BỘ TÀI LIỆU TẠI ĐÂY:

Tổng kết

Như vậy, ustone.com.vn đã chia sẻ đến cho mình bộ tài liệu xây dựng C cho tất cả những người mới bắt đầu. Cỗ tài liệu này trọn vẹn miễn phí giành riêng cho những chúng ta nào đang mới bắt đầu theo đuổi say mê lập trình muốn mày mò về thiết kế C. Chúc chúng ta sớm hoàn toàn có thể tìm thấy hồ hết giá trị tuyệt đối hoàn hảo của cỗ tài liệu mà chúng tôi chia sẻ.